This hotel suited our budget which was mid range. The Congo is situated perfectly near nice restaurants, pharmacy and the centre of Glyfada all within walking distance. The beach which is just opposite is a public one which offers NO sunbeds. Personally this was an issue for me as I don’t like putting my towel on the sand. We got a quick taxi to Voula beach and Vouligmeni beach which you pay 15€ for but this comes with beds and umbrellas & clean facilities ie, showers, changing rooms and WC. In a nutshell the Congo Palace has a great location in Glyfada. It’s clean with our room being cleaned daily but it is dated. Our family room had no natural light so it was very dark and was carpeted which I didn’t like. The pool is basic and could do with modernising too. Nice pool bar / restaurant though. Helpful staff, couldn’t fault them.

I booked on Booking.con for 11 nights. My son and I were traveling together. I have been to Glyfada many times and from the outside and lobby Congo Palace looked great. The room we were given had dirty smelly carpet, the coils in the mattress were felt as you laid down. I went down to ask for another room and was told I needed to upgrade…which I did. The renovated room was nice but the shower had no curtain and water went everywhere. They were doing construction and the noise was awful. The noise from the road was ridiculous, felt like I was sleeping in the road. To make matters worse, my son was sick and we left 5 days early. They refused to speak with me about a refund. They did not return emails to Booking or me. I have emailed 3 times with no response. Staff was nice to my face but I would never recommend this hotel to anyone.

The hotel seems to be in the process of renovation while remaining open for business. Your experience will vary greatly from the room you get. The room we stayed in corresponds in no way to the very nice design language of the lobby. It was dilapidated, the double bed we requested was twin beds brought close to each other while one of them was rocking sideways. Everywhere there are signs of old repairs and constructions that haven't been finished and are done very poorly. In general the photos on the internet uploaded by the property are a gross misrepresentation of reality. Although the location is nice, it is far from worth the money. Look for other places, this one is horrible.
